Britains greatest skunk cannabis-smuggling squad confronting prison

A drugs gang became so rich importing cannabis that it left 225,000 to rot in a damp safe.

The smugglers, who brought the "skunk" into Britain hidden in boxes of flowers from Holland, are believed to have made an estimated 62million.

Atone point, the gang was shipping in consignments worth up to 750,000 aweek and would use an East London bureau de change to clean up its"dirty" profits.

Terrence Bowler will be sentenced, along with 11 others, at Southwark Crown Court in London for his leading role in what is believed to be Britain"s most prolific skunk cannabis-smuggling rings.
